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.

SQL Anywhere 11.0.1 (中文) » SQL Anywhere 服务器 - 编程 » 部署 SQL Anywhere » 部署数据库和应用程序 » 部署客户端应用程序 » 部署 ODBC 客户端

 

ODBC 驱动程序所需的文件

下表显示运行 SQL Anywhere ODBC 驱动程序所需的文件。这些文件应放在单一目录中。SQL Anywhere 安装将它们全部置于 SQL Anywhere 安装目录的操作系统子目录中(如 bin32bin64)。

用于 Linux、Unix 和 Mac OS X 平台的 ODBC 驱动程序多线程版本由 "MT" 表示。

平台 所需文件
Windows

dbodbc11.dll

dbcon11.dll

dbicu11.dll

dbicudt11.dll

dblg[xx]11.dll

dbelevate11.exe

Windows Mobile

dbodbc11.dll

dbicu11.dll(可选)

dbicudt11.dat(可选)

dblg[xx]11.dll

Linux、Solaris、HP-UX

libdbodbc11.so.1

libdbodbc11_n.so.1

libdbodm11.so.1

libdbtasks11.so.1

libdbicu11.so.1

libdbicudt11.so.1

dblg[xx]11.res

Linux、Solaris、HP-UX MT

libdbodbc11.so.1

libdbodbc11_r.so.1

libdbodm11.so.1

libdbtasks11_r.so.1

libdbicu11_r.so.1

libdbicudt11.so.1

dblg[xx]11.res

AIX

libdbodbc11.so

libdbodbc11_n.so

libdbodm11.so

libdbtasks11.so

libdbicu11.so

libdbicudt11.so

dblg[xx]11.res

AIX MT

libdbodbc11.so

libdbodbc11_r.so

libdbodm11.so

libdbtasks11_r.so

libdbicu11_r.so

libdbicudt11.so

dblg[xx]11.res

Mac OS X

dbodbc11.bundle

libdbodbc11.dylib

libdbodbc11_n.dylib

libdbodm11.dylib

libdbtasks11.dylib

libdbicu11.dylib

libdbicudt11.dylib

dblg[xx]11.res

Mac OS X MT

dbodbc11_r.bundle

libdbodbc11.dylib

libdbodbc11_r.dylib

libdbodm11.dylib

libdbtasks11_r.dylib

libdbicu11_r.dylib

libdbicudt11.dylib

dblg[xx]11.res

注意
  • 对于 Linux 和 Solaris 平台,应创建指向 .so.1 文件的链接。此链接名应与删除了 ".1" 版本后缀的文件名匹配。

  • 有几个适用于 Linux、Unix 和 Mac OS X 平台的 ODBC 驱动程序多线程 (MT) 版本。其文件名包含 "_r" 后缀。如果您的应用程序需要这些文件,则可以对其进行部署。

  • 对于 Windows,驱动程序管理器包括在操作系统中。对于 Linux、Unix 和 Mac OS X 平台,SQL Anywhere 提供了驱动程序管理器。此文件名以 libdbodm11 开始。

  • 注意,对于 Windows Vista 或更高版本的 Windows,必须包含 SQL Anywhere 已提升的操作代理 (dbelevate11.exe) 以支持注册或注销 ODBC 驱动程序所需的权限提升。此文件仅为 ODBC 驱动程序安装或卸载过程所必需。

  • 还应包括语言资源库文件。上表显示了带有标志 [xx] 的文件。这表示消息文件有多个,每个消息文件支持不同的语言。如果要安装对不同语言的支持,必须添加这些语言的资源文件。

  • 对于 Windows,在以下情况下需要 [连接] 窗口支持代码 (dbcon11.dll):最终用户要创建各自的数据源;他们需要在连接到数据库时输入用户 ID 和口令;或者他们出于任何其它目的需要显示 [连接] 窗口。